<h2>7 Β· Methodology &amp; honest scope</h2>
<div class="r-method">
<p><strong>This is an exposure briefing, not a damage probability or insurance rating.</strong> Tier and headline statistics are computed from a deterministic, peer-reviewed-grounded rubric (see <em>METHODOLOGY.md</em> in the source repository). The synthesis prose is generated by IBM Granite 4.1 in document-grounded mode; every numeric claim is verified to appear verbatim in a source document before render, and unsupported sentences are dropped.</p>
<p><strong>Stack:</strong> Granite 4.1 (3b planner / 8b reconciler) via Ollama, Granite Embedding 278M for RAG over agency reports, Granite TimeSeries TTM r2 for live surge nowcast, Prithvi-EO 2.0 for satellite-derived flood polygons (offline pre-computed). Apache-2.0 across the stack. Inference runs locally on the deploying machine; no vendor LLM is contacted at runtime.</p>
<p><strong>Out of scope:</strong> engineering vulnerability (foundation/structural fragility), social capacity, financial absorption, sub-surface flooding (basement apartments, subway entrances). Datasets are vintage-bounded as noted per source above.</p>

// Subset markdown for the briefing: `**Header.**` lines β†’ <h4>; `- ` lines
// β†’ <ul><li>; inline `**foo**` β†’ <strong>; rest β†’ <p>. Keep parity with
// agent.js's renderMarkdown so reports look like the live UI.
function renderBriefingMarkdown(text) {
const lines = text.split("\n");
const out = [];
let para = []; let bullets = [];
const flushPara = () => {
if (!para.length) return;
const safe = para.join(" ").trim().replace(/\*\*([^*]+)\*\*/g, "<strong>$1</strong>");
if (safe) out.push(`<p>${safe}</p>`);
para = [];
};
const flushBullets = () => {
if (!bullets.length) return;
const items = bullets.map(b => {
const safe = b.trim().replace(/\*\*([^*]+)\*\*/g, "<strong>$1</strong>");
return `<li>${safe}</li>`;
}).join("");
out.push(`<ul>${items}</ul>`);
bullets = [];
};
// Pre-split inline-bullet runs that Granite occasionally emits as one line
const expanded = [];
for (const line of lines) {
if (line.trim().startsWith("- ") && line.includes(" - ", 2)) {
const parts = line.split(/(?:^|(?<=\.\s))\s*-\s+/g).filter(p => p.trim());
for (const p of parts) expanded.push("- " + p.trim());
} else { expanded.push(line); }
}
for (const line of expanded) {
const m = line.match(/^\s*\*\*([A-Z][A-Za-z\s/]+)\.\*\*\s*$/);
if (m) {
flushPara(); flushBullets();
out.push(`<h4>${m[1]}</h4>`);
} else if (/^\s*[-*]\s+/.test(line)) {
flushPara();
bullets.push(line.replace(/^\s*[-*]\s+/, ""));
} else {
flushBullets();
para.push(line);
}
}
flushPara(); flushBullets();
return out.join("");
}
